What Are Scoliid Wasps?
Scoliid wasps belong to the family Scoliidae, a group of solitary wasps known for their robust bodies and often striking coloration. They are sometimes called “flower wasps” because adult scoliod wasps frequently visit flowers to feed on nectar. Unlike social wasps, scoliid wasps do not live in colonies and do not have a queen or workers.
These wasps measure between 10 to 30 millimeters in length and are mostly black with yellow or orange markings. Their bodies are stout and hairy, which sometimes causes them to be mistaken for bumblebees.
Physical Characteristics
- Size: Adult scoliod wasps generally range from 1 to 3 centimeters long.
- Coloration: They commonly have black bodies with yellow or orange spots or bands on the thorax and abdomen.
- Wings: Their wings can vary from transparent to slightly smoky with iridescent hues.
- Hairiness: Many species have dense hair on their bodies, which helps in pollen collection during flower visits.
- Antennae: Males tend to have longer and more curved antennae compared to females.
Their robust build enables them to capture and subdue relatively large prey, which is crucial for their reproductive cycle.
Lifecycle and Behavior
Parasitic Nature
One of the most notable aspects of scoliid wasp behavior is their parasitic relationship with beetle larvae, especially those of scarab beetles (such as June bugs and Japanese beetles). Female scoliid wasps locate and paralyze these larvae by stinging them. After immobilizing the host larva, the wasp lays a single egg on the victim’s body.
The egg hatches into a larva that feeds externally on the beetle grub, eventually killing it. This parasitic behavior is beneficial in controlling populations of beetles that can become pests in gardens, lawns, and agricultural fields.
Solitary Lifestyle
Unlike social wasps such as paper wasps or yellowjackets, scoliid wasps lead solitary lives. Females independently search for hosts and provision their nests without assistance. They do not produce colonies or maintain any social hierarchy.
Flight and Flower Visitation
Adult scoliid wasps are active flyers during warm months. They visit flowers primarily to consume nectar, which provides them with energy for flight and reproduction. Because of this feeding habit, they also contribute to pollination, albeit less significantly than bees.
Ecological Importance
Natural Pest Control
Scoliid wasps serve as natural biological control agents by regulating scarab beetle populations. Many scarab beetles are notorious for damaging turfgrass roots and crop plants during their larval stage. By parasitizing these larvae, scoliid wasps reduce the number of harmful beetles without the need for chemical pesticides.
This makes them valuable allies for gardeners, turf managers, and organic farmers seeking sustainable pest management strategies.
Pollination Role
While not primary pollinators like honeybees or bumblebees, scoliid wasps contribute modestly to pollination when they visit flowers for nectar. They inadvertently transfer pollen between blooms during feeding.
Biodiversity Indicators
Because scoliid wasps depend on specific habitats that support both flowers and scarab beetle larvae, their presence can indicate a healthy ecosystem with diverse insect communities.
Distribution and Habitat
Scoliid wasps are found worldwide but are particularly diverse in temperate and tropical regions. They favor habitats such as:
- Meadows
- Gardens
- Forest edges
- Grasslands
- Agricultural areas with sufficient floral resources and soil suitable for scarab larvae
Females search soil environments extensively to find buried beetle larvae as hosts for their offspring.
Common Species of Scoliid Wasps
Some frequently encountered species include:
- Scolia dubia (Two-spotted Scoliid Wasp): Common in North America; recognizable by two yellow spots on its mostly black abdomen.
- Triscolia ardens: Found in parts of North America; noted for bright orange regions on its body.
- Campsomeris spp.: These large tropical scoliods often appear striking with bold color patterns.
Each species varies slightly in size, color patterns, and host preferences but shares similar life history traits.

Are Scoliid Wasps Dangerous?
Many people fear all wasps due to painful stings, but scoliid wasps are generally non-aggressive toward humans. They only sting when directly handled or threatened. Their stings can be painful but are rarely medically significant unless allergic reactions occur.
Because they do not defend nests like social wasps do—since they don’t form colonies—they pose little risk during outdoor activities. Observing them from a respectful distance is safe.

Interesting Facts About Scoliid Wasps
- Some species have been observed carrying prey weighing several times their own body weight—a testament to their strength.
- The female’s sting injects venom that selectively paralyzes but does not kill the host immediately; this keeps it fresh for larval feeding.
- Their hairy bodies help accumulate pollen grains while visiting flowers—a feature convergent with bees.
- Scoliad diversity peaks in tropical regions but many species thrive in temperate zones too.
- Unlike many parasitic insects that lay numerous eggs per host, scoliiid females generally deposit one egg per scarab larva ensuring adequate nourishment for their offspring.
